    This concept centers on consistently optimized weekly pricing structures that minimize recurring expenses over time. Rather than large upfront commitments, users access predictable, often time-limited rates that cap or reduce weekly outlays. For example, some digital services offer discounted weekly access, letting customers pause, adjust, or downgrade without penalties. Similarly, flexible financing plans package repayments into weekly installments, simplifying budget tracking. The savings emerge not from magic, but from smarter rate selection, competitive benchmarking, and automated enforcement—keeping costs lower with less effort.
